UTPA Soccer Chases Elusive First Victory Against Jacksonville

MOBILE, Ala. - Still searching for their elusive first victory of a frustrating soccer season, the University of Texas-Pan American Broncs battle Jacksonville of Florida at noon Monday.

This will end UTPA's three-game visit to the Sun Belt Conference Mini-Tournament. This is a warm-up for the real SBC Championship in Little Rock Nov. 4-6.

Western Kentucky handed the unlucky UTPA Broncs their ninth straight defeat in a bitterly fought battle Saturday night, 3-1. 

WKU's Hilltoppers scored on Tom Morgan's goal in the 13th minute. Mario Ribera of UTPA equalized by scoring on a free kick in the 39th minute. It stayed 1-1 at halftime.

Alois Bunjira of WKU then scored twice, breaking the tie with a penalty kick in the 58th minute when Ribera was ejected with a red-card foul. Bunjira scored the clincher in the 72nd minute.

Tony Hesler of WKU was red-carded in the 74th minute. WKU made 21 total fouls, UTPA 18. Each side drew three yellow cards plus one red.

WKU improved to 6-7 with its second straight win on a neutral field in Mobile. WKU bumps into host South Alabama Monday.
